Analysis

Türkiye recorded 134.29 for chillies and peppers, green (capsicum spp. and pimenta spp.) — gross in 2024. That is the highest value across all 64 years on record.

That represents a change of up 11.0% on the previous year and up 37.0% over ten years.

Over the whole period, chillies and peppers, green (capsicum spp. and pimenta spp.) — gross in Türkiye peaked at 134.29 in 2024 and was at its lowest, 25, in 1968.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 64 years of available data.

The FAO indices of agricultural production show the relative level of the aggregate volume of agricultural production for each year in comparison with the base period 2014-2016. Indices for meat production are computed based on data on production from indigenous animals.
